GAIN STRONG HANDS-ON WITH :
- OneLake & Shortcuts - Learn how to access data instantly across domains with OneLake’s game-changing shortcuts.
- Fabric Data Factory - Build real-time, end-to-end pipelines with powerful visual tools and dataflows.
- Lakehouse Architecture - Discover how to combine data engineering and analytics in one powerful environment.
- PySpark Development in Notebooks - Use Notebookutils, environment configs, and PySpark magic to build real projects inside Microsoft Fabric
- Data Warehouse + T-SQL Mastery - Write complex stored procedures, functions, and T-SQL queries like a pro — with tips, tricks, and real examples.
- Real-Time Analytics with KQL - Master Kusto Query Language (KQL) to build blazing-fast real-time dashboards using Eventstream, Eventhouse, and KQL DB.
- CI/CD for Fabric Projects - Automate deployments using Azure DevOps + Fabric Pipelines.
- Data Governance Simplified - Understand lineage, endorsements, sensitivity labels and more.
- M Language - Build ETL solutions using Power Query M code
- Materialized Lake Views - Build modern PySpark workflows using the latest MLV framework.
